Pulim Kulambu (II) — Overview

Pulim Kulambu (II) is a second variant of the tamarind-based formulation prepared with Trikatu, Jeeraka, Hingu, Chitraka, Gaja Pippali, Krishna Jeeraka, Saindhava and Ajamoda combined with Lasuna kalka, Kandabija patra juice, Tandulodaka, tamarind juice and Eranda Taila.

It is administered in a dose equivalent to the size of an Udumbara fruit and is indicated in Gulma (abdominal tumors), Antra Soola (intestinal pain) and Trika Soola (sacral/lower back pain).

Source: Sahasra Yoga, Pak, Leha, Rasayana, Vati and Gutika Prakarana
